WebAug 11, 2024 · Explanation: The standard form of a parabola is y = ax2 + + bx +c, where a ≠ 0. The vertex is the minimum or maximum point of a parabola. If a > 0, the vertex is the minimum point and the parabola opens upward. If a < 0, the vertex is the maximum point and the parabola opens downward. WebIn the standard form, the vertex (V) of the parabola is given by V = (-b/2a, -D/4a) Where D is discriminant = b 2 - 4ac The vertex equation of a parabola is of the form y = a (x - h) 2 + k The vertex of the parabola is at the coordinate (h, k) The vertex of the parabola (h, k) = (-b/2a, -D/4a) Let's see an example to understand briefly.
